Background
The air filter assembly is mainly applied to the fields of pneumatic machinery, internal combustion machinery and the like, and is used for providing clean air for the mechanical equipment so as to prevent the mechanical equipment from sucking air with foreign particles in work and increasing the probability of abrasion and damage. The main components of the air cleaner assembly are a filter element, which is the primary filter portion, which undertakes the filtering of the air, and a housing, which is the external structure that provides the necessary protection for the filter element. The air cleaner is required to be capable of performing high-efficiency air cleaning operation, not to increase excessive resistance to air flow, and to be capable of continuous operation for a long time.
After the air filter assembly works for a long time, the filter element needs to be cleaned or replaced regularly, and when the filter element is replaced, the shell and the filter element need to be disassembled, but the existing air filter has a complex structure, is extremely inconvenient to disassemble, and cannot achieve the purpose of quick disassembly and assembly; meanwhile, part of the air filter is of an integral structure and cannot be disassembled, so that the air filter can be integrally replaced, and unnecessary waste is caused.

Referring to fig. 1 to 3, the air-cooled electric spray air cleaner assembly includes a first casing 100, a second casing 200, and a filter element 300, wherein the first casing 100 and the second casing 200 are covered with each other and detachably connected, the filter element 300 is disposed between the first casing 100 and the second casing 200, a first groove 110 is disposed at an edge of the first casing 100, a second groove 210 is disposed at an edge of the second casing 200, sealing rings (not shown) are disposed in the first groove 110 and the second groove 210, the filter element 300 includes a fixing plate 310, a filter paper 320, and a filter screen 330, an opening is disposed in a middle of the fixing plate 310, the filter paper 320 is disposed on one side of the opening, the filter screen 330 is disposed on the other side of the opening, clamping strips 340 protruding from both sides are disposed at edges of the fixing plate 310, and the clamping strips 340 are respectively matched with the first groove 110 and the second groove 210.
Specifically, in order to facilitate replacement of the filter element 300, in this embodiment, the first casing 100 and the second casing 200 are covered with each other and detachably connected by screws and threads, in addition, the first groove 110 and the second groove 210 are respectively arranged at the covered position of the first casing 100 and the second casing 200, and meanwhile, the edge of the fixing plate 310 of the filter element 300 is provided with the clamping strips 340 protruding from both sides, when the filter element 300 is installed, the clamping strips 340 on both sides are respectively clamped in the first groove 110 and the second groove 120, and then the first casing 100 and the second casing 200 are fastened, so that the connection structure of the first casing 100, the second casing 200 and the filter element 300 is simple, and meanwhile, the filter element 300 can be conveniently disassembled and assembled and disassembled, and the filter element 300 can be quickly replaced;
in order to seal the first casing 100, the second casing 200 and the filter element 300 after being installed, the first groove 110 and the second groove 210 are respectively provided with a sealing ring, and the sealing effect can be achieved through the matching between the sealing rings and the clamping strips 340, so that the air-cooled electronic injection air filter assembly can normally operate;
in addition, the filter element 300 of the present embodiment includes a fixing plate 310, a filter paper 320 and a filter screen 330, wherein the filter paper 320 and the filter screen 330 are respectively disposed at two sides of the fixing plate 310 in an opposite manner, when the engine sucks a large amount of air, the air is filtered by the filter paper 320, and meanwhile, in order to prevent the filter paper 320 from being damaged due to an impact force generated when the engine sucks air, the filter screen 330 is disposed at the opposite side of the filter paper 320, and the filter paper 320 is blocked by the filter screen 330, so that the damage of the filter paper 320 due to the impact force can be effectively prevented, thereby improving the service life of the filter element 300.
Referring to fig. 1 and 2, the first housing 100 is provided with an air inlet pipe 120, the air inlet pipe 120 penetrates through a side wall of the first housing 100 to form an air inlet 130, and one side of the fixing plate 310, which is provided with the filter paper 320, is adjacent to the first housing 100.
The second casing 200 is provided with an air suction pipe 220, one end of the air suction pipe 220 penetrates through the side wall of the second casing 200 to form an air suction port 230, the second casing 200 is further provided with a sewage discharge port 240 and is connected to the outside of the second casing 200 through a pipeline 250, and the side, provided with the filter screen 330, of the fixing plate 310 is adjacent to the second casing 200.
An air suction pipe 220 of the air-cooled electronic injection air filter assembly is connected with an engine, when the air-cooled electronic injection air filter assembly works, air enters through an air inlet 130 and enters into a first shell 100 along an air inlet pipe 120, the air is filtered through filter paper 320 of a filter element 300 and then enters into a second shell 200, and then the filtered air is sucked into the engine through an air suction port 230 along the air suction pipe 220; after the engine operates by sucking air, a certain amount of waste water and waste oil substances can be generated, and can be stored along the pipeline 250 through the drain outlet 240 and discharged to the outside, so that the service life of the air-cooled electronic injection air filter assembly is prolonged.
Further, referring to fig. 2, a fixing post 260 is disposed on the second housing 200 near the air suction pipe 220, and a fixing hole 270 matched with the fixing post 260 is disposed on the air suction pipe 220.
Meanwhile, the first housing 100 and the second housing 200 are respectively provided with a reinforcing rib 400.
In addition, the intake pipe 120 and the intake pipe 220 are made of rubber.
In this embodiment, in order to effectively reduce noise of the air-cooled electronic injection air filter assembly, the air inlet pipe 110 and the air suction pipe 220 are made of rubber, and the air suction pipe 220 is fixedly connected with the fixing column 260 through the fixing hole 270, so as to prevent the air suction pipe 220 from vibrating when a large amount of air is sucked, thereby reducing noise generated during the operation of the air-cooled electronic injection air filter assembly; the reinforcing ribs are arranged on the first shell 100 and the second shell 200, so that the strength and rigidity of the first shell 100 and the second shell 200 can be improved, the wall of the first shell 100 and the wall of the second shell 200 are not thickened, and the first shell 100 and the second shell 200 can be prevented from being deformed.
